阅读导航一、正排索引1. 概念2. 实例二、倒排索引1. 概念2. 实例三、正排 VS 倒排1. 正排索引优缺点2. 倒排索引优缺点3. 应用场景三、搜索引擎原理1. 宏观原理2. 具体原理一、正排索引1. 概念正排索引是一...
-
oracle 数据库 正排索引 vs 倒排索引 - 搜索引擎具体原理
-
数据库 Oracle WebLogic Server远程代码执行漏洞 CVE-2020-14750 已亲自复现
环境启动后,访问http://192.168.63.129:7001/console/login/LoginForm.jsp,说明已成功启动。漏洞利用需要注意的是,需要我们先登录才行,不登陆就无法进行未授权,weblogic...
-
oracle 数据库系统概念 第七版 中文答案 第2章 关系模型介绍
第2章 关系模型介绍2.1 考虑图 2.17 中的员工数据库。这些关系上适当的主码是什么?相应的主键如下所示:2.2 考虑从 instructor 的 dept_name 属性到 department 关系的外键约束。请给...
-
数据库 oracle Sqlserver
关系型数据库主从节点的延迟是否和隔离级别有关联,个人认为两者没有直接关系,主从延迟在关系型数据库中一般和这两个时间有关:事务日志从主节点传输到从节点的时间+事务日志在从节点的应用时间事务日志从主节点传输到从节点的时间,相关因...
-
数据库 dba Oracle创建DBlink
Oracle创建DBlink查看DBlink情况创建和删除其他有时候会存在在登录A数据库时需要访问B数据库的库表的需求,此时可以建立对B库的DBlink连接去访问。 例如,当我们在使用A数据库下的A_TEST用户登录A数据库...
-
oracle11 sql [Oracle]编写一个程序,用于接受用户输入的数字,将该数左右反转,然后显示反转后的数。测试案例:输入:1234567 输出:7654321 要求编写程序,输入n个字符,统计其中英文字母、数
目录实验七 PL/SQL语言一、 实验目的二、实验要求三、 实验内容(1)编写一个程序,输入玩具的价格,比较玩具的价格并显示折扣,如果价格高于或等于500元,则优惠150元;价格高于或等于400元,则优惠100元;如果价格...
-
oracle 郝斌老师 sql 语句笔记
一、数据库是如何解决数据存储问题的从三个方面来学习数据库数据库是如何存储的字段,记录,表,约束主键,外键,唯一键,非空,触发器数据库是如何操作数据的存储过程,函数, 触发器数据库是如何显示数据的重点中的重点必备的一些操作如何...
-
数据库 dba Oracle系列之二:Oracle数据字典
数据字典1. 什么是Oracle数据字典2. 数据字典的内容3. 数据字典应用示例1. 什么是Oracle数据字典数据字典(Data Dictionary)是Oracle元数据(Metadata)的存储地点,汇集了数据库对象...
-
oracle 服务器 达梦数据库8用户管理以及忘记sysdba密码修改办法
达梦数据库8用户管理&达梦数据库v8忘记sysdba密码,修改办法。 达梦数据库8用户管理 1.创建用户的语法: 2.锁定/解锁用户 3.修改用户的密码(同样要符合密码策略PWD_POLICY) 4.修改用户默认表空间 5....
-
数据库 oracle Django中db.sqlite3 文件
在创建 Django 框架项目时,db.sqlite3 文件是 Django 默认创建的数据库文件。它是一个轻量级的 SQLite 数据库文件,用于存储项目中的数据。Django 采用了一种称为 ORM(对象关系映射)的技术...
-
oracle sql 经验分享 笔记 Oracel数据库将两个select查询语句的结果拼接在一起的两种方式
如果我们想将两个sql查询语句的结果拼接在一起,有两种方式:一种是使用UNION操作符,拼接行、另一种是使用CROSS JOIN操作符,拼接列。方式一:UNIONUNION 操作符用于合并两个或多个 SELECT 语句的结果...
-
adb android gaussdb 数据库 oracle 【项目实战经验】DataKit迁移MySQL到openGauss(下)
上一篇我们分享了安装、设置、链接、启动等步骤,本篇我们将继续分享迁移、启动~目录 9. 离线迁移9.1. 迁移插件安装中断安装,比如 kill 掉java进程(安装失败也要等待300s)下载安装包准备上传缺少mysqlcli...
-
数据库 ORACLE TO POSTGRESQL 来自2天上海的印象
开头还是介绍一下群,如果感兴趣polardb ,mongodb ,mysql ,postgresql ,redis 等有问题,有需求都可以加群群内有各大数据库行业大咖,CTO,可以解决你的问题。加群请联系 liuaustin...
-
java 开发语言 tomcat通过jdbc连接Oracle12c时报ORA-28040:没有匹配的验证协议错误
tomcat通过jdbc连接Oracle12c时报ORA-28040:没有匹配的验证协议错误提示:Invocation of init method failed; nested exception is java.sql....
-
dba 运维 服务器 使用window客户端远程连接虚拟机上的oracle数据库常见的连接问题
常见问题一:ORA-12541: TNS:no listener解决办法:在虚拟机上找到oracle对应权限的用户,去执行监控端口的启动//启动监听服务//停止监听服务//查看监听状态常见问题二:ORA-12514:TNS:...
-
数据库 dba 运维 sql Oracle-AWR快照无法自动生成问题分析
前言:近期处理了一起数据库AWR快照无法自动生成的问题,用户发现数据库在近期出现了AWR快照无法自动生成的问题,数据库整体负载正常,后面分析发现原因是由于AWR快照在生成过程中,执行的SQL语句出现超时导致。问题:Oracl...
-
数据库 Oracle : 应当以 SYSDBA 身份或 SYSOPER 身份建立 SYS 连接
问题描述正常输入用户名的口令,就会报错,因为SYS是在数据库之外的超级管理员解决策略控制台登录在密码后加上as sysdbaplsql 登录将“连接为”选项框的Normal改为SYSDBA或SYSOPER,即可登录成功。...
-
oracle 数据库 dba应具备的素质 运维 linux 【浅谈DBA 职业素质】---读书笔记
【上一篇】The Begin点点关注,收藏不迷路【下一篇】【来自DBA大佬的见解1】对于一个准备进入 DBA 领域的人,我希望他勤奋、严谨、具有钻研精神及独立思考能力。 如果不是要求特别高的职位,其实一般技术...
-
数据库 dba sql 开发语言 【Oracle】包
文章目录包的定义包的创建和调用包的初始化包的持续性包的串行化包的管理系统工具包包的定义在PL/SQL程序开发中,为了方便实现模块化程序的管理,可以将PL/SQL元素(如存储过程、函数、变量、常量、自定义数据类型、游标等)根据...
-
java PLSQL连接Oracle 数据库配置详解
1. 下载instantclient-basic-win32-11.2.0.1.0(oracle官网下载地址:http://www.oracle.com/technetwork/topics/winsoft-085727.h...
-
java Oracle不支持的字符集 (在类路径中添加 orai18n.jar): ZHS16GBK
1.报错内容出现 java.sql.SQLException: 不支持的字符集 (在类路径中添加 orai18n.jar : ZHS16GBKException in thread "main" java.sql.SQLEx...
-
数据库 记一次Oracle ORA-01013和DBMS
1.问题出现因业务需要,数据库中有一张表每时每刻都有数据插入,数据量比较庞大,都是些物联网数据。最近一段时间,发现在工作日周一至周五晚上10点多,和周六周日早上6点多发生数据插入失败的情况,经日志记录,在insert那张表时...
-
java 数据库 oracle 字符串从后往前截取
在Oracle数据库中,我们可以使用substr函数和greatest函数来实现从字符串的末尾开始截取一定长度的子串。首先,让我们来了解一下substr函数。substr函数用于从字符串中截取一定长度的子串。它的语法如下:其...
-
java spring boot SpringBoot集成mybatis和mysql、oracle双数据源
1、添加依赖2、编写配置文件3、数据源配置类文件4、根据上述数据源路径,编写dao层和mapper文件...
-
oracle 数据库 了解PL/SQL看这一篇够够了~
目录一、什么是PL/SQL二、PL/SQL的优点2.1有利于C/S环境的运行2.2适合于客户环境2.3PL/SQL可用的SQL语句三、运行PL/SQL程序四、块结构五、块结构解析六、块分类七、子块八、标识符一、什么是PL/S...
-
数据库管理-第146期 最强Oracle监控EMCC深入使用-03(20240206)
数据库管理145期 2024-02-06数据库管理-第146期 最强Oracle监控EMCC深入使用-03(20240206)1 概览2 性能中心3 性能中心-Exadata总结数据库管理-第146期 最强Oracle监控E...
-
【Oracle】Oracle SQL性能优化最好用的技巧
1) 选择最有效率的表名顺序(只在基于规则的优化器中有效 :ORACLE的解析器按照从右到左的顺序处理FROM子句中的表名,FROM子句中写在最后的表(基础表 driving table 将被最先处理,在FROM子...
-
Oracle SQL 性能优化
向量I/O 回表SQL 不一样,plan 一样的除了统计信息,session 参数导致COST不对历史执行计划 filter 不同于nest loop 会distinct 之类 放进PGA 不再是SGA中块访问了吧fzw r...
-
迁移学习 数据库迁移教程之SQLServer到Oracle
前置知识SQL Server数据库是微软官方出品的一款数据库,官方指定的数据库连接工具为Microsoft SQL Server Management Studio xx(简称SSMS,xx为版本代码,如11、12、13等 ...
-
Oracle 19c数据库的卸载(彻底卸载可重新在该盘安装)
此文章参考于b站Oracle06_Oracle的卸载_哔哩哔哩_bilibili,在此感谢该老师愿意分享各种干货! 由于之前安装时在Net Configuration Assistant出错,想了很多办法都一直没有解决...
-
oracle 开发语言 数据库 Python 数据持久层ORM框架 SQLAlchemy模块
文章目录ORM 框架SQLAlchemy 简介SQLAlchemy 作用SQLAlchemy 原理SQLAlchemy 使用流程数据库驱动配置关系型数据库配置NoSQL数据库配置创建引擎(Engine 定义模型类(ORM 创...
-
数据库 oracle 同一张表同时insert多条数据 mysql 同一张表同时insert多条数据
oracle 同一张表同时insert多条数据在Oracle数据库中,你可以使用INSERT ALL语句同时向同一张表插入多条数据。INSERT ALL语句允许你一次执行多个插入操作,可以提高插入的效率和速度。 以下是使用I...
-
oracle tomcat 数据库 学习 MyBatis 的一点小总结 —— 底层源码初步分析
目录MyBatis 如何获取数据库源?MyBatis 如何获取 sql 语句?MyBatis 如何执行 sql 语句?MyBatis 如何实现不同类型数据之间的转换?在过去程序员使用 JDBC 连接数据库,总会带来诸多不便。...
-
oracle 数据库 2022 年公众号 JiekeXu DBA之路历史文章合集
作者 | JiekeXu大家好,我是JiekeXu,很高兴又和大家见面了,欢迎点击上方蓝字关注我,标星或置顶,更多干货第一时间到达!光阴似箭,时间又过去了一年,不知不觉 2022 年也已经过去了,这一年也是疫情当下的一年,看...
-
oracle sql 【数据库管理】⑩数据字典
1. 数据字典的概述数据字典(Data Dictionary)是数据库管理系统中的一个重要组成部分,它是一个存储数据库元数据的集合,包含了数据库中所有对象的定义和描述信息。数据字典可以帮助用户了解数据库中的各种对象和数据结...
-
容器 macos Mac如何安装Oracle?Mac如何配置Docker?手把手教你配置Docker并配置Oracle
!!!安装前准备:请提前安装好jdk1.先去官网下载Doker,下载好以后安装并打开Docker,安装成功后,mac最上面导航栏会出现Docker图标,可以在终端中输入docker --version来查看Docker版本D...
-
数据库 oracle和mysql语法区别大吗
一、数据类型 1. Number类型 MySQL中是没有Number类型的,但有int/decimal 类型,Oracle中的Number(5,1 对应MySQL中的decimal(5,1 ,Number(5 对应 int...
-
数据库 Oracle中的行列转换
目录一、行转列(一)二、行转列(二) 三、列转行(一)四、列转行(二)行列转换是指将行数据转换为列数据,或将列数据转换为行数据的过程。这通常使用的办法是用PIVOT和UNPIVOT函数来实现。这里描述两种方法分别实现行列转换...
-
Windows11安装使用Oracle21C详细步骤<图文保姆级>新版本
Windows11安装使用Oracle21C详细步骤新版本Database Software Downloads | Oracle 中国 下载完成后解压缩双击setup.exe 打开安装页面同意下一步 更改自己的路径点击下一...
-
数据库 服务器 数据备份与恢复--Oracle和MySQL笔记
1、Oracle与MySQL简介:1)racle是大型的数据库而Mysql是中小型数据库;2)Mysql是开源的,Oracle是收费的,且价格昂贵。3 oracle与mysql的区别2、Oracle与MySQL基本概念3、实...
-
数据库 Oracle的下载及安装教程(小白也能轻松上手)
文章目录Oracle的概述Oracle的下载Oracle的安装验证安装情况Oracle的概述Oracle Database,又叫Oracle RDBMS,或者简称Oracle。是甲骨文公司的一款关系数据库管理系统。它是一直在...
-
数据库 【推荐】Oracle Live SQL——在线 Oracle SQL 测试工具
最近回答了几个 CSDN “学习”功能里“问答”区的一些专业相关问题,回答过程中采用严谨的方式,在 Oracle Live SQL 上进行验证测试。这个很好用的 Oracle APEX 应用我使用好几年了,虽然近年来已转行...
-
oracle 数据库 web安全 渗透测试 网络安全 安全 SQL 注入漏洞原理以及修复方法
漏洞名称 :SQL注入 、SQL盲注漏洞描述:所谓SQL注入,就是通过把SQL命令插入到Web表单提交或输入域名或页面请求的查询字符串,最终达到欺骗服务器执行恶意的SQL命令。具体来说,它是利用现有应用程序,将(恶意)的SQ...
-
数据库 sql DBA Oracle自动化巡检脚本出炉
巡检脚本如下:select '一、数据库的基本情况' from dual;select '1、数据库版本' from dual;select '2、查看数据库基本信息' from dual;select '3、实例状态'...
-
数据库 Oracle19c给scott,plustrace用户授予dba权限报错
...
-
最新oracle 数据库官网下载教程
第一步:进去官网https://www.oracle.com/ 第二步骤点击 Resources 第三步骤看下图 第四步骤 点击进去继续点击 第五步骤重点来了 只有下图这个版本支持有windows oracle 数据库版本,...
-
数据库 ORA-01034: ORACLE not available?一文解决
1.情况描述 oracle用户sqlplus登陆数据库(11gR2 + 单机asm),进去查询一些基本的视图发现报错 ORA-01034: ORACLE not available,详细如下SQ...
-
数据库 oracle 开发语言 java PL/SQL的词法单元
目录字符集标识符分隔符注释oracle从入门到总裁:https://blog.csdn.net/weixin_67859959/article/details/135209645PL/SQL块中的每一条语句都必须...
-
大数据 Flink CDC 实时抽取 Oracle 数据-排错&调优
前言Flink CDC 于 2021 年 11 月 15 日发布了最新版本 2.1,该版本通过引入内置 Debezium 组件,增加了对 Oracle 的支持。对该版本进行试用并成功实现了对 Oracle 的实时数据捕获以及...
-
oracle NoSQL数据库的数据库引擎兼容性
1.背景介绍1. 背景介绍NoSQL数据库是一种非关系型数据库,它的设计目标是为了解决传统关系型数据库(如MySQL、Oracle等 在处理大规模、高并发、高可扩展性等方面的不足。NoSQL数据库可以分为五种类型:键值存储(...